The meteoric rise of Megaupload, however, was inextricably linked to its legal downfall. The entertainment industries, long protective of their intellectual property, viewed the site as a rampant haven for copyright infringement. The scale of the operation was unprecedented, and in January 2012, a coordinated international action led by the FBI saw the arrest of Dotcom and his associates in a dramatic raid on his lavish New Zealand estate. The charges were severe: racketeering, conspiracy to commit copyright infringement, and money laundering. The takedown of Megaupload sent shockwaves through the internet, resulting in the immediate loss of what was then a significant portion of the web's content. For many, Dotcom became a symbol of the entertainment industry’s heavy-handed tactics against technological progress. Yet, for others, he was a criminal who had profited immensely from the theft of creative work.

When we dissect the data, the picture becomes one of bifurcation rather than uniform prosperity. Median net worth is calculated by taking the midpoint of all households; this means that half of American families have assets below this calculated point and half above. The problem arises from the nature of assets in this calculation. For many middle-class households, the primary and often singular asset is their residence. Real estate, however, is a uniquely illiquid asset; it cannot be easily converted to cover an unexpected medical bill or a car repair. Furthermore, the prevalence of consumer debt, including high-interest credit card balances and student loans, actively works to deplete liquid savings. Therefore, the statistical median can often mask the reality of "asset-rich, cash-poor" individuals who technically own property but lack the financial flexibility to navigate emergencies, pushing them perilously close to a net worth of zero when liabilities are subtracted from liquid or semi-liquid assets.
